Seasonal · Tuesdays at 6:00 PM

Summer Group Lessons.

An ensemble-style setting where students learn to follow a conductor. Our summer season focuses on building community through music, culminating in an informal concert on the final evening.

A small faculty, each a working musician.

Five faculty members — each a dedicated musician — carrying the studio between them. The studio stays small on purpose — so every student is known, and every lesson is prepared for.

i

Jonathan George

President

After a successful career as a professional pilot, Jonathan took over as President of Kingston Strings Music Society in 2026. He is deeply committed to providing world-class music education in the Annapolis Valley, focusing on excellence in both music and character development. He also enjoys lutherie, violin making and violin family bow maintenance in his spare time. ii

Amy Spurr-Caveney

Vice President

Amy began her violin journey with Kingston Strings and is now a full-time violinist and regularly plays with the Nova Scotia Symphony Orchestra and other well know musicians. With degrees from Memorial University and the University of Toronto, she oversees the Society's professional standards and faculty development, and is deeply committed to providing a quality learning experience for all students.

iii

Roger F. Taylor

Head Instructor

A teacher with Kingston Strings since 2005, Roger was educated in the UK (Bristol) and France. He is an accomplished composer, performer, and RCM theory expert who leads the instrumental programs with a focus on refined technique and musicality.

iv

Emily Nyenhuis

Instructor

Emily holds honors in RCM Piano and Violin (Level 9). She combines her advanced studies with a dedicated teaching practice, fostering a love for music in students of all ages through her own studio and at the Kingston Strings Music Society.

v

Aleksa Lear

Ensemble Instructor

With a lifelong devotion to the violin, Aleksa specializes in fostering nurturing environments where technical proficiency meets a deep, intuitive love for the craft. Aleksa leads our Summer Group Lessons, guiding students through the collaborative process of ensemble performance.
